Accessorize Lovelily is an Eau de Parfum launched in 2016, created by Beverley Bayne. Lovelily opens with Raspberry, Bergamot, and Orange, settles into a heart of Lily Of The Valley and Jasmine, and dries down to a base of Musk and Vanilla. About

Lovelily opens with a brief, watery whisper of raspberry, orange and bergamot, a fleeting fruity facade that quickly gives way to a rather generic white floral heart. Predictable lily of the valley and jasmine vie for attention, struggling to rise above the thin, synthetic musk and vanilla base. It's clean, inoffensively sweet, but ultimately lacks any distinguishing features, fading quickly into a powdery non-event.
